Brighton-based DIY psych-punk legend Dez Dare is on tour fresh off the release of his new album 'CHERYL! Your Love Shines Down Like A Supernova's Death'.

Support comes from Edinburgh's garage/synth punk prophets

Sha Rivari & the Maybes.

Their claim to fame is last year's support slot with Jon Spencer at The Cluny.

Local fuzzed-up disco fart-rockers Super Burner will be opening the show. The band includes members of Ten Benson, Nine Tons, Collapsed Lung and Apache Viking.
